Software Developer
www.metinpolat.net

Html5 İle Kullanımdan Kaldırılan Etiketler

0 18

HTML 5 İle Gelen Etiketler

HTML5 HTML 4.1 den sonra çıkan HTML sürümüdür ve HTML5’in gelmesiyle web geliştiriciler için büyük kolaylıklar sağlanmıştır.

Browserların gelişmesi ve yeni kodlama temellerinin atılması HTML’in de kendini geliştirmesinin önünü açmış oldu.

HTML 5 ile gelen yeni etiketler;

<canvas>, <audio>, <video>, <time>, <summary>, <source>, <progress>, <caption>, <ruby>, <rt>, <rp>, <output>, <meter>, <mark>, <keygen>, <header>, <nav>, <footer>, <article>, <hggroup>, <figure>, <figcaption>, <embed>, <aside>, <command>,<datalist>, <details>

Bu etiketler HTML 5 ile birlikte gelirken, HTML ve XHTML sürümlerinde kalan ve artık kullanılmayacak olan etiketlerde oldular.

<acronym>, <xnm>, <u>, <tt>, <strike>, <applet>, <basefont>, <big>, <center>, <dir>, <font>, <s>, <noframes>, <frameset>, <frame>

HTML 5 ile gelen tüm yenilikler arama motorları ve tarayıcıların siteleri daha sağlıklı bir şekilde yorumlayabilmeleri için türetilmişlerdir.

Aynı şekilde kullanımdan kaldırılan etiketlerin etkilerini CSS ile yapabiliyor olmamız artık kullanılmalarına sebep olmuştur.

HTML 5 ile birlikte sadece etiketler getirilmedi. Aynı zamanda parametrelerde de değişiklikler ve yenilikler oldu; autocomplate, autofocus, form, form overrides, list, min, max, height, width, step, multiple,pattern, placeholder.

 

Yeni HTML5 Etiketleri

HTML5 ile birlikte bir çok etiket tanımı geldi. Genel olarak;

  • <header><footer><article><section> vb. gibi semantik (anlamsal) etiket tanımları.
  • numberdatetimecalendarrange vb. gibi form etiketlerinde nitelik tanımları.
  • Grafik tanımları için <svg> ve <canvas> etiket tanımları.
  • Multimedya tanımları için <video> ve <audio> etiket tanımları gibi.

HTML5’de Silinen Etiketler

HTML’in 5. sürümüyle birlikte bazı etiketler kullanımdan kaldırıldı ve onun yerine ya farklı etiketler getirildi ya da iş tamamen CSS kısmına bırakıldı.

Kaldırılen Etiket Yerine Kullanılacak Olan
<acronym> <abbr>
<applet> <object>
<basefont> CSS
<big> CSS
<center> CSS
<dir> <ul>
<font> CSS
<frame>
<frameset>
<noframes>
<strike> CSS, <s> ya da <del>
<tt> CSS
Abone Ol
En son haberleri, gelişmeleri ve blog yazılarımı doğrudan gelen kutunuza almak için buradan abone olabilirsiniz.
İstediğiniz zaman abonelikten çıkabilirsiniz

Yorum Yazın

E-posta hesabınız yayımlanmayacak.